区块链简介

区块链是一种分布式账本技术,它允许在没有中介的情况下进行安全的交易。区块链通过一个网络中多个节点的数据存储方式,确保了数据的透明性和不可篡改性。区块链技术广泛应用于金融、物流、版权保护等多个领域,而公链作为区块链的一种重要类型,尤其值得关注。

什么是公链

: 区块链中的公链详解:什么是公链及其应用潜力

公链(Public Blockchain)是指任何人都可以参与的区块链网络。在这种网络中,任何人都可以加入、读取、发送交易信息,并且对网络的治理和维护有平等的权利。这种开放性特点使公链成为去中心化体系的核心,激励着社区成员间的合作和创新。

公链的运行依赖于去中心化的共识机制,比如工作量证明(Proof of Work)和权益证明(Proof of Stake),这些机制确保了网络的安全性和透明性。这意味着,即使没有中央管理者,公链也能够在用户之间建立信任关系。

公链的特点

公链具有几个显著的特点,使其在区块链生态系统中脱颖而出:

  • 开放性:任何人都可以参与,无需许可。
  • 去中心化:没有单一的控制者,权力分散在整个网络中。
  • 不可篡改性:交易记录一旦被确认,就无法被更改或删除。
  • 透明性:所有的交易信息对所有参与者公开,任何人都可以查阅。

公链的应用场景

: 区块链中的公链详解:什么是公链及其应用潜力

公链在多个领域已经得到了成功应用,下面我们将详细探讨其中几种重要应用:

1. 加密货币

最初的比特币就是建立在公链上的,它开创了去中心化的货币概念。公链允许用户进行无国界的转账,而无需中介机构的介入。

2. 智能合约

以太坊是一个运行智能合约的公链平台。智能合约是运行在区块链上的程序,它能自动执行合约条款,无需中介。这一应用已经在各种行业中展现了其巨大的潜力。

3. 去中心化金融(DeFi)

公链在去中心化金融领域发挥了重大的作用。用户能够直接在区块链上进行借贷、交易和投资,而不需要传统金融机构的参与,这提供了更多的金融自由度和透明性。

4. 数字身份管理

公链可以帮助个人管理他们的数字身份。用户能够在区块链上验证自己的身份,而不是依赖传统的身份验证方式,这种方式更安全且高效。

公链的挑战与未来发展

尽管公链技术拥有广泛的应用潜力,但在其发展过程中也面临诸多挑战:

1. 可扩展性问题

公链在处理大量交易时,常常出现速度慢、确认时间长的问题。这是因为需要全网络节点共同验证每一笔交易,这在交易量激增时极其耗时。

2. 能耗问题

以比特币为例,其工作量证明机制需要消耗大量计算资源,导致电力消耗高昂,这引发了关于环保的争论。

3. 政策与监管

随着区块链技术的迅速发展,各国政府对其监管也愈发严格,这可能限制其自由的发展空间。

尽管存在上述挑战,公链仍然是技术创新的重要方向。伴随技术的进步,未来的公链有望实现更高的效率、更低的能耗以及更全面的应用。

关于公链的常见问题

1. 公链和私链的区别是什么?

公链与私链在开放性、控制权和使用场景等方面有明显的区别。公链是完全开放的,任何人都可以参与。而私链则由特定机构控制,参与用户需获得许可。

私链的交易速度通常较快,因为其节点数目较少,且不需要全网络参与共识。但公链由于分散化特性,安全性更高,广泛应用于数字货币、智能合约等领域。随着行业的不同需求,公链和私链各自展示了其独特的优势,可能在未来共存并互补。

2. 公链是如何确保安全性的?

公链通过多种机制确保其安全性,最重要的是共识机制。以比特币为例,其采用的工作量证明机制,通过解决复杂的数学问题来阻止恶意用户破坏网络。

此外,公链的去中心化特性使得攻击者难以掌控多数节点,进一步提升了网络安全性。同时,公链中的智能合约也能够被审计和验证,减少了程序漏洞导致的安全风险。

3. 公链的交易费用是如何计算的?

在公链上,交易费用一般由用户自主设置,费用越高,区块打包的优先级就越高。以太坊等公链采用的费用机制是动态的,当网络拥塞时,用户可能需要支付更高的费用以确保交易能迅速被处理。

这种费用机制激励节点矿工参与验证工作,而用户则需平衡成本与时间的关系。在未来,随着技术的改善,交易费用可能会下降并变得更具透明性。

4. 公链的治理机制是怎样的?

公链的治理机制可以分为链上治理和链下治理。链上治理是指通过网络中的投票机制来对协议进行修改或升级。链下治理是非正式的,并通过开发者、社区讨论等多种方式进行。

不同公链的治理机制各不相同,部分项目实施的是主动更新,而另一些项目则可能采取更为保守的策略。这一过程可能伴随着激烈的争议和意见分歧,也彰显了去中心化的特点。

5. 公链的未来趋势是什么?

展望未来,公链将继续朝着更高的安全性、可扩展性和持续性发展。随着技术的不断进步,共识机制、改进交易效率是研究的重点。

此外,公链将逐步向更多应用场景延伸,推动去中心化金融、数字身份等新兴领域的快速发展。随着对区块链技术理解的深化,公链的应用潜力也将被不断挖掘,为社会可靠性和透明度贡献力量。

总结而言,公链作为区块链的一个重要组成部分,具备了众多优点与潜力,推动了许多新兴应用的出现。然而,其面临的挑战也不容小觑,未来的发展仍需在技术与治理层面不断推进。